> I hope you are correct that you worked VU7AG.
>
> Be advised that last evening [i.e. Sunday evening Oklahoma Time] that the guy on 10.104 Mhz was NOT VU7AG. Instead the station there was PJ7/G3TXF. I thought I worked VU7AG at 22:47Z because there were some spots saying that the guy on 10.104Mhz was VU7AG.
>
> But after "working" him I continued to listen to him for another half an hour. I thought he was too strong to really be VU7AG. I thought maybe he was a pirate. But after listening to him carefully for another half an hour -- when he had sent his call a couple of times -- it became evident that the station really was PJ7/G3TXF. He was only giving his call every ten minutes or so. So you had to listen carefully to know who you were working.
>
> I notice that I am NOT in VU7AG's log on 30 meters and you are not either. According to the VU7AG online log the log cutoff time is 02:42Z on 09 Dec. I think we would both be in his online log if we really did work him.
